Phenolic fabric tubes, also called bakelite tubes or fabric-reinforced bushings, are made by hot-rolling cotton fabric that is coated with phenolic resin. As a result, these parts provide excellent insulation, good wear resistance, and strong mechanical performance. In addition, they are widely used for custom-made items such as bushings, washers, and structural insulators.

3240 Epoxy Resin Boards and Parts are made from fiberglass cloth impregnated with epoxy resin, then hot-pressed and cured. They offer excellent mechanical strength, dielectric performance, and heat resistance. Ideal for electrical insulation parts, especially in humid environments or transformer oil.

FR4 Epoxy Insulation Rods and Bolts are manufactured by pultruding fiberglass filaments impregnated with epoxy resin under high temperature and vacuum-controlled extrusion. These rods offer excellent dielectric properties, high mechanical strength, and smooth surfaces free from bubbles, oil, or impurities.
Available in multiple diameters (⌀6mm–⌀170mm), shapes (round, hex, square), and customizable lengths. Ideal for electrical insulation structures exposed to heat, humidity, and transformer oil.

A fast, traceable workflow for CNC-machined insulation components.
Select high-quality phenolic sheets or laminated tubes according to application.
Raw boards or rods are cut into manageable blanks for further processing.
Ensure flatness or roundness before CNC machining for better accuracy.
Import CAD drawings and set machining parameters based on tolerances.
Use CNC routers or mills for drilling, slotting, contour shaping, and turning.
Edge polishing and chamfering to avoid sharp edges or fiber burrs.
Check critical dimensions using calipers or 3D probes; tolerance ±0.1mm.
Remove cutting dust and apply optional anti-humidity coating.
Parts are labeled, packed by batch, and dispatched within 7 days.
